Greek Candidate in German Federal Elections

ellines_germany1-630x354DW pays a tribute to the Greek candidates in the upcoming German elections.

Stella Kyrgiane – Ephremidis has great chances of being elected as a member of the German parliament.

She grew up in Württemberg, went to a German school , got married and gave birth to a child. In 1985 she became a member of the German Social Democratic Party SPD.

A key criterion for this choice was the fact that the SPD not only accepted foreigners as members, but also gave them the chance to rise. In 1991, Stella Kyrgiane – Ephremidis progressively became a municipal and prefecture councilor, a member of the Bureau SPD in Baden -Württemberg, an MEP candidate and now a candidate for Bundestag in the constituency Zollernalb- Sigmaringen.

The popular politician also had proposals to be candidate in two other regions but she chose the place where she grew up.

However, this area is considered the Christian Democrat bulwark. Candidates can be elected usually with over 50 % of the votes. The place Stella Kyrgiane – Ephremidis has on the list gives her more chances to become the first MP of Greek origin in Germany.
